Writer's Block
A condition, often temporary, where an author loses the ability to produce new work or experiences a creative slowdown.
Mind Mapping
A visual tool that involves drawing diagrams to represent tasks, words, concepts, or items linked to and arranged around a central concept.
Freewriting
A writing strategy intended to promote idea generation and fluid thought without concern for grammar, punctuation, or editing during the initial process.
Seven C's
A concept often related to effective communication comprising clarity, conciseness, concreteness, correctness, coherence, completeness, and courtesy.
